Bath Meadow - B63 2XH
Key Street Insights
Bath Meadow is a residential street with 33 addresses.
It ranks as the 228th largest and 57th most expensive of the 422 streets in the B63 area. The most common property type is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.
The street contains a total of 33 properties: 25 houses, 3 flats and 5 other properties.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Bath Meadow sold for £187,000 on 28th February 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 5.0%.
The current average value in the street is £159,178.
The Bath Meadow Sales Market has increased by 45.7% over the last 10 years.
